The Tanzanian Championship (formerly, Second Division League and "Ligi Daraja la Kwanza" in Swahili) is the second tier of league football in Tanzania. The league is made up of sixteen teams that play thirty rounds, home and away.The league was formed in 1930.
The top two teams at the end of the season get promoted to the Tanzania Premier League, while the third and fourth go into a playoff with two last-placed teams not eligible for automatic relegation. The last two teams are relegated to the first division, while the last four teams go into a playoff. The two winners in the playoffs are retained, while the two losing teams are relegated to the First League.
